I recently bought a canon SELPHY cp810 off Facebook market place because it was the cheapest option for a student like me and I want to start a photo album of my family. I also have a canon powerboat g7x mark ii that I take photos with ( I use a SanDisk Ultra Plus SD card). When I put the SD card in the SELPHY, all my pictures show up as a yellow question mark (ALL) but when I place another sad card in it (Lexar Platinum II), the photos show up and can be printed.
I assumed the problem was the image type and when I checked I realised all my photos on the SanDisk are cr2 format while the Lexar photos were in jpg format. I tried changing the format of some photos on my SanDisk memory card to jpg but they still show as a question mark when I try to print them on my SELPHY. How do I fix this?
Note that the SELPHY though old is not the problem, it prints the other photos just fine! Thank you.

A .CR2 file is a RAW image file that needs to be processed before it can be printed. Changing the file suffix to .jpg doesn't alter the file contents.
You need to download Canon Digital Photo Professional (DPP4) and use it to open and then print your files.
